Quote (Shirl86 @ Nov 16 2012 03:07am)
Just a question:
what would be the trade off changing Danetta's with a Dead Man Legacy 190+dex / 20 ias / 10cc + other stats?


its an option but you would lose like 200% Crit damage which is a huge dps drop, and I'm not 100% sure but I dont think the 10% CC and 20ias makes up for it, you also lose about 25% discipline. On the other hand you will probably gain more life and a faster ASPS. Dex is negligible since they both have ~200dex. If you plan on doing that you might as well just use a basic Manticore build, with that you will have a slower ASPS though.
